Abstract

Abstract: The stomach is a critical organ within the human digestive system, and gastric diseases represent significant health concerns often underestimated by the public. Factors such as poor dietary habits, stress, and bacterial infections contribute to these ailments, whose initial symptoms can easily be misinterpreted due to their similarity with other gastrointestinal disorders. The knowledge gap exists in the diagnostic challenges faced by both patients and healthcare professionals, necessitating the development of improved diagnostic tools. This study aims to enhance the diagnostic process for gastric diseases through the implementation of an expert system utilizing the Fuzzy Tsukamoto method. By employing questionnaires and expert interviews to gather data on symptoms, we develop a comprehensive fuzzy inference system. Results indicate that the system accurately classifies stomach ailments based on user-reported symptoms, facilitating early diagnosis and treatment. The novelty of this research lies in the application of the Fuzzy Tsukamoto method, which allows for nuanced symptom analysis and inference, providing a more accessible means for the general public to identify potential gastric diseases. Furthermore, the system design includes flowcharts, data flow diagrams, and entity relationship diagrams to ensure a user-friendly interface. The implications of this study are significant, as it offers a robust tool for early detection of gastric diseases, thereby potentially improving patient outcomes and reducing healthcare costs associated with late-stage interventions. This expert system not only assists in diagnosing gastric conditions but also serves as a valuable resource for enhancing the understanding of symptomology in gastroenterology.

Abstract

Tomat merupakan salah satu jenis sayuran yang banyak diminati oleh masyarakat dan memiliki permintaan tinggi di pasaran. Tingginya tingkat permintaan tomat membuka peluang budidaya tomat menjadi lebih banyak. Oleh karena itu, perlu adanya inovasi budidaya tanaman tomat. Tujuan penelitian ini adalah untuk mengetahui pertumbuhan tanaman tomat setelah pemberian vitamin B1 dan hormone giberelin. Penelitian ini menggunakan metode kuantitatif eksperimental rancangan acak lengkap (RAL) dua faktor masing-masing 4 kali ulangan dengan komposisi P0 (kontrol), P1 (pemberian Vitamin B1 0.2 ml), P2 (pemberian hormon giberelin 0.2 ml), P3 (pemberian Vitamin B1 dan hormone giberelin 0.2 ml), dan P4 (pemberian Vitamin B1 dan hormone giberelin 0.4 ml).Data dianalisis menggunakan Two Way Annova untuk mengetahui pertumbuhan dan hasil paling baik pada perlakuan tersebut.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a pertumbuhan tanaman tomat terbaik terdapat pada perlakuan P1 (pemberian Vitamin B1 0.2 ml) dengan rerata tinggi tanaman 85.37 cm, jumlah daun 229,5 helai, dan jumlah bunga 15 buah.
